Repository of problems worth solving

World Solve is a public institutional repository for identifying real unresolved problems across science, society, health, governance, economics, and local systems. Each entry is intended to be citable, inspectable, and actionable.

Publicly citable Every problem has a stable citation code for reference and discussion.
Filtered by relevance Search by category, geography, status, and keywords.
Builder-oriented Use the repository to find startup ideas, policy leads, and research agendas.

Growing desalination could produce concentrated brine and chemical waste at scales that threaten coastal ecosystems. The challenge is improving recovery and discharge methods while accounting for cumulative regional impacts. Global connectivity increasingly depends on vulnerable subsea cables exposed to anchors, accidents, sabotage, natural hazards, and unclear legal responsibility. Future resilience requires diversified routes, monitoring, repair capacity, and international cooperation.
